New York North Country Landscape and Village Reverie
In a reflective travelogue the writer recalls northern New York scenery from the St. Lawrence to Niagara Falls, praising varied terrain and classic sites from old wars to romantic writers. He describes a childhood home near LakeOntario, a village at Lay, and a serene bayside landscape with sand points, ridges, and fragrant Balm of Gilead trees that fostered memory and imagination.

A Bay Tour Through Huron County’s Lakes and Isles
A narrator guides a reader along Norwalk Bay describing beaches, islands, forests, and a fisher village. He recalls a lone old fisherman, bass fishing from shore, duck hunts, and torchlight spearing near the creeks. The journey ends at a graveyard visit and reflections on scenery, peach orchards, and sunset over Ontario.

Overland Emigrant Route News from Plains Short-Lived Hardships
A correspondent describes emigrants crossing west of the South Fork of the Cibola River in harsh weather and scarce provisions. A youthful traveler, with five biscuits and a small bundle, was turned adrift after being questioned. The Placer Times notes a party of about forty reached Weaverville on June 6 after leaving Missouri in early spring, overcoming deep snow and rough mountains. The group traveled over 30 miles daily and reported healthy animals and good grazing, explaining the rapid journey despite conditions.
